Design of Multi-Time Scale Power Trading Platform in Regional Spot Market

In order to improve the reliability of power trading under the background of regional power spot market, a multi-time scale power trading platform is designed. The transaction status of foreign power spot markets, the general situation of China's power market construction and the particularity of China's market transactions are analyzed. A multi-time-scale trading platform in the spot market is constructed, the overall structure and technical architecture of the platform are established, the multi-time-scale transaction process is analyzed, and a clearing mechanism framework for cross-regional transactions is proposed. According to the needs of market connection, the basic plan for cross-regional transactions is proposed. Finally, the application effect analysis of the platform proposed in this paper is carried out, which shows the validity of the platform design.
